Given the clean MOT history, a buyer should prioritise an in-person inspection of the suspension components, including coil springs, bushes, and dampers, as these are critical for handling and safety at elevated mileages. The brakes—particularly the rear calipers and discs—should be checked for uneven wear or binding, as Tesla’s regenerative braking system can sometimes lead to uneven pad or rotor degradation. Additionally, the high mileage suggests the tyres may be nearing their tread limits, even if not yet failing an MOT. Structural corrosion, while less common in Tesla models, should be examined at wheel arches, sills, and underbody seams, especially if the vehicle has been exposed to salt or poor parking conditions. The absence of advisories does not guarantee these areas are flawless, so visual and functional checks are essential.
